Dr. Bruno Machado has been hired as a specialist in urinary system surgeries and minimally invasive endoscopic techniques at the University of Arkansas for Medical Sciences in Little Rock.
Machado is an assistant professor in the Department of Urology in the College of Medicine and is seeing patients in the Urology Clinic.
He received his medical degree from Fluminense Federal University in Brazil. He completed a residency in general surgery at Hospital Geral de Nova Iguacu in Brazil and a residency in urology at the Hospital Universitario Clementino Fraga Filho in Brazil, and completed a fellowship in laparoscopic robotic surgery at the Clinique Saint Augustin in France.
Drs. Rob Winningham, Kaitlin Cockerell and John Cockerell have been hired at the Sherwood Family Medical Center, a Baptist Health affiliate in Sherwood.
Winningham received his medical degree from the Quillen College of Medicine in Tennessee and completed a residency in pediatrics at Greenville Health Systems in South Carolina.
Kaitlin Cockerell received her medical degree and completed her residency at the University of Arkansas for Medical Sciences.
Her husband, John, will start in August and also received his medical degree and completed his family medicine residency at UAMS.
Dr. Krishna Kakkera has joined the White River Health System Batesville Pulmonology Clinic, where he is now seeing patients.
Kakkera, who is board-certified by the American Board of Internal Medicine in internal medicine and pulmonology and board-eligible in critical care, received his medical degree from Osmania Medical College, affiliated with NTR University of Health Sciences in Hyderabad, Telangana, India. He completed an internship and residency in internal medicine and a fellowship in pulmonary and critical care medicine at the University of Arkansas for Medical Sciences.
